Acute subdural hematoma. Spontaneous forms of arterial origin

Eur Neurol. 1981;20(1):4-8. doi: 10.1159/000115196.

Abstract

3 cases of acute subdural hematoma associated with bleeding from cortical arteries are described. There was no history of trauma. Referred cases in the literature and the possible mechanisms are discussed.
